  • Why you should become a Cabin cleaner?
    A cabin cleaner should be familiar with the interior of an aircraft and clean all areas according to procedure. Their typical responsibilities are to stock supplies, vacuum floors, pick up trash, refill seat pockets, and clean cockpit windows
